Freiburg’s Senegalese goal-machine Papiss Demba Cisse has revealed his desire to move to Premier League outfit Liverpool. Liverpool and Arsenal have been linked with the 25-year-old in recent months; and when asked about the interest shown in him from Anfield he said: "Liverpool is a dream club. Salif Diao and El Hadji Diouf have played there. But to be honest I am happy here at the moment.
"But you never know in football. Things can develop quickly."
Cisse has scored 16 goals in 22 league games so far this season, two less than the division's leading goal-scorer Mario Gomez, who has hit 18.
